- The distance between Anderson, In, Usa and Pointe-À-Pitre, Guadeloupe is approximately 3,545 km or 2,203 mi.
- To reach Anderson, In in this distance one would set out from Pointe-À-Pitre bearing 323°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Anderson, In bearing 311.1° or NW .
- Anderson, In has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Pointe-À-Pitre has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
- The annual average temperature is 15.1 °C (27.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 23.1 °C (41.6°F) more in Anderson, In.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 836.9 mm (32.9 in) less which is equivalent to 836.9 l/m² (20.54 US gal/ft²) or 8,369,000 l/ha (894,702 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.2° lower in Anderson, In than in Pointe-À-Pitre.
